We have a client who has had Microsoft Edge updates causing the extension to go to a not registered status.
This was resolved by setting Edge 'Notifications' for 3CX site from Ask (default) to 'Allow'

Hello @sodey

That is correct, notifications should be changed to "Allow" on the browser for the extension to be registered.

Regarding the pop up notifications.
Please make sure the computer's notification settings and check if it is allowed to notify?
